The full picture

Inside a simple strip-mall exterior, the room feels warm and inviting with Georgian textiles and clay pans sizzling to the table. Service is often friendly and helpful, guiding first-timers through dumplings and pies. One diner noted, "It felt like dinner at a Georgian home." The culinary approach leans traditional and hearty: classic Georgian staples like khachapuri, khinkali, and clay-pot stews, focused on freshness and bold seasonings over flash. Standouts include a gooey cheese bread and a richly spiced beef chashushuli that regulars rave about. Families are welcome here: kids gravitate to dumplings and cheese bread, and portions are built for sharing. There is no stated kids menu, but options like Ajaruli khachapuri, Imeruli pies, and mild chicken dishes make it approachable for younger palates.
